Alex Rins Eyes Move to Go Eleven's WorldSBK Ducati After Losing His Yamaha Seat

After Yamaha declined to renew his contract, Alex Rins is reportedly exploring a move to independent WorldSBK Ducati squad Go Eleven for 2027, riding the Panigale V4. He has begun preliminary talks with team management, though securing an estimated €300,000 budget and competing with incumbent rider Lorenzo Baldassarri's sponsor backing remain hurdles.

Alex Rins Negotiates a WorldSBK Move With Go Eleven After His MotoGP Exit

Alex Rins is negotiating a move to World Superbike with the Go Eleven Ducati Panigale V4 team after leaving MotoGP. The team is weighing a roughly €300,000 investment to field a second bike. Rins admitted "there's honestly nothing for me in the MotoGP paddock next year" after three difficult seasons at Yamaha, and said finding a competitive project matters more than being on a factory team.

Japanese MotoGP Offers Free Entry and Grandstand Access to Ages 16–23

The 2026 Japanese MotoGP at Mobility Resort Motegi will offer a free 16–23 ZERO Pass for registered visitors aged 16 to 23. It covers venue admission, general seating and the reservation-only shuttle from Haga Industrial Park Management Center; the LRT fare from Utsunomiya remains separate. Night Live and After Race Live music performances are also included.
